Since November 2014 Jan de Keijser is working as a Professor of Criminology at the Institute of Criminal Law and Criminology.
In 2010, Jan joined the Department of Criminology as an Associate Professor. Since November 2014, he has been a Professor of Criminology at the Institute for Criminal Law & Criminology. He studied political science at Leiden University. In March 2000, he received his PhD cum laude in social sciences from Leiden University with a dissertation on the significance of theories of punishment in the practice of sentencing.
Research
His research interests focus on factors that affect the legitimacy of the criminal justice system. This includes research into judicial decision-making processes regarding evidence and sentencing, public perceptions of crime and law enforcement, and the interaction between legal professionals and technical forensic experts. His research involves nearly all (professional) participants in the process (police, public prosecutors, judges, lawyers, experts), as well as public opinion. The research is situated at the intersection of criminal law and social sciences and is characterized by the use and combination of diverse qualitative and quantitative approaches. He has published books and articles in national and international journals on, among other things, expert evidence, evaluation of police reports, the social responsiveness of judges, the gap between judges and society, moral theories of punishment, purposes of punishment, judicial sentencing, and public opinion on punishment.
